Transaction 51d80d3408a6a9e72a2d2dcd80df7756638151286b2b162cea2f76ff3c4b2101
2 Input
2 Outputs
- 51d80d3408a6a9e72a2d2dcd80df7756638151286b2b162cea2f76ff3c4b2101:0
- 51d80d3408a6a9e72a2d2dcd80df7756638151286b2b162cea2f76ff3c4b2101:1
value 659175
address 1CnabiqDZ7R93nTFkyxdP6DbbLxddDjUxq
value 43057515
address 12e1Ajf3VCGcNtyi2YGyCnQeqbdxrsTAzp